Output 3508806857e9f08c5a23588d65c41ec17db130561c95ef8f1898cd4dafaa4bee:0

value
103500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4695dc0cce3ced74e58dd2cb1089a2d21b07ee2 OP_EQUAL
address
3KbYb7gdavPsJpgWyorZ3fyJxZnnV9SN27
transaction
3508806857e9f08c5a23588d65c41ec17db130561c95ef8f1898cd4dafaa4bee
spent
true